Principle of Rationality

Principle of Rationality

Definición de Principle of Rationality

El Principle of Rationality en inteligencia artificial se refiere a la capacidad de un agente para actuar de manera lógica y eficiente, tomando decisiones que maximicen sus objetivos dados los recursos e información disponibles. Un agente racional no actúa de forma aleatoria, sino que evalúa cuidadosamente las posibles acciones y elige aquella que ofrece el mayor beneficio o utilidad esperada. Este principio es fundamental para el diseño de sistemas inteligentes, ya que garantiza que las decisiones sean coherentes y orientadas hacia un fin específico. Además, la racionalidad puede ser perfecta o limitada, dependiendo de las restricciones computacionales y la información accesible. 

Contexto Histórico y Filosófico

El contexto histórico y filosófico del Principle of Rationality en inteligencia artificial tiene sus raíces en la lógica clásica, la filosofía de la mente y la teoría económica. Desde la antigüedad, pensadores como Aristóteles exploraron la idea de la racionalidad como el uso correcto de la razón para tomar decisiones. Más adelante, en el siglo XX, la teoría de la decisión y la economía racional formalizaron el concepto de agentes que buscan maximizar su utilidad. En filosofía, la racionalidad se ha analizado como un criterio para distinguir decisiones sensatas de las irracionales. Estos fundamentos han influido directamente en la IA, donde la racionalidad se traduce en algoritmos que imitan el proceso humano de toma de decisiones óptimas. Así, el Principle of Rationality une disciplinas diversas para fundamentar el comportamiento inteligente.

Racionalidad en Agentes Inteligentes

La racionalidad en agentes inteligentes implica que estos sistemas toman decisiones basadas en la evaluación cuidadosa de la información disponible para alcanzar sus objetivos de manera eficiente. Un agente inteligente no actúa al azar, sino que selecciona la acción que maximiza sus posibilidades de éxito según su conocimiento y capacidades. Esta racionalidad permite que los agentes adapten su comportamiento a diferentes contextos y desafíos, optimizando sus respuestas. Además, la racionalidad asegura que las decisiones sean coherentes y justificadas, evitando acciones arbitrarias. Así, los agentes inteligentes pueden desempeñarse de forma autónoma y efectiva en entornos complejos.

Tipos de Racionalidad en IA

En inteligencia artificial, existen principalmente dos tipos de racionalidad: la racionalidad perfecta y la racionalidad limitada. La racionalidad perfecta supone que el agente tiene acceso a toda la información necesaria y capacidad computacional ilimitada para elegir siempre la mejor acción posible. Sin embargo, en la práctica, esto es raro debido a restricciones de tiempo y recursos. Por eso, la racionalidad limitada reconoce estas limitaciones y busca soluciones satisfactorias, aunque no sean óptimas. Esta distinción permite diseñar agentes que funcionan eficazmente en entornos reales, adaptándose a la complejidad y a la incertidumbre. 

Implementación Práctica en Sistemas de IA

La implementación práctica del Principle of Rationality en sistemas de inteligencia artificial se refleja en el diseño de algoritmos que permiten a los agentes tomar decisiones eficientes y coherentes. Por ejemplo, en sistemas de planificación, los agentes evalúan múltiples acciones posibles y eligen la que mejor cumple sus objetivos. En el aprendizaje automático, los modelos ajustan sus parámetros para maximizar la precisión o minimizar el error, siguiendo un criterio racional. También se aplica en sistemas expertos, donde las reglas se estructuran para guiar decisiones lógicas. Por otra parte, en robótica, la racionalidad permite a los robots actuar de forma adaptativa frente a su entorno. 

Racionalidad y la Toma de Decisiones Bajo Incertidumbre

La racionalidad en la toma de decisiones bajo incertidumbre es esencial en inteligencia artificial, ya que muchos entornos no ofrecen información completa o precisa. En estos casos, los agentes deben evaluar probabilidades y consecuencias para actuar de la manera más razonable posible. Se utilizan modelos como redes bayesianas, teoría de la decisión y árboles de decisión para estimar los resultados esperados. La idea es que, incluso sin certezas absolutas, el agente elija la acción que maximice la utilidad esperada. Este enfoque permite a los sistemas adaptarse a situaciones dinámicas y riesgosas. Así, la racionalidad bajo incertidumbre combina lógica y probabilidad para guiar decisiones óptimas. 

Ejemplos de Aplicación

El Principle of Rationality se aplica en numerosos sistemas de inteligencia artificial presentes en la vida cotidiana y en entornos especializados. En los asistentes virtuales, como Siri o Alexa, permite seleccionar respuestas útiles según las intenciones del usuario. En los sistemas de recomendación, como los de Netflix o Amazon, se usa para sugerir productos que maximicen la satisfacción del usuario. En robótica, guía a los robots para tomar decisiones óptimas en navegación o manipulación de objetos. También es clave en vehículos autónomos, donde se evalúan múltiples rutas y acciones en tiempo real. En los videojuegos, los personajes controlados por IA actúan racionalmente para ofrecer desafíos realistas. 

Ventajas y Limitaciones del Principle of Rationality

El Principle of Rationality ofrece ventajas clave en el desarrollo de inteligencia artificial, como la toma de decisiones coherente, orientada a objetivos y optimizada según la información disponible. Este enfoque mejora la eficiencia y la adaptabilidad de los sistemas, especialmente en entornos complejos. Sin embargo, también presenta limitaciones importantes. La racionalidad perfecta rara vez es alcanzable debido a restricciones de tiempo, recursos computacionales e información incompleta. Además, en contextos ambiguos o cambiantes, actuar racionalmente puede requerir aproximaciones heurísticas que no siempre garantizan el mejor resultado. Estas limitaciones han llevado al desarrollo de modelos de racionalidad limitada, más realistas para aplicaciones prácticas.

Futuro del Principle of Rationality en IA

El futuro del Principle of Rationality en inteligencia artificial apunta hacia una racionalidad más flexible, adaptativa y contextual. A medida que los sistemas se enfrentan a entornos más dinámicos y complejos, se espera que los agentes puedan ajustar sus estrategias racionales en tiempo real. Esto incluye combinar la racionalidad limitada con técnicas de aprendizaje automático para mejorar la toma de decisiones basadas en experiencia. También se prevé una mayor integración de factores éticos y sociales, ampliando el concepto de racionalidad más allá de la eficiencia individual. En la IA general, la racionalidad podría abarcar la comprensión del comportamiento humano y la colaboración entre agentes. 

Comparte este Post:

Posts Relacionados

Character Set

En el desarrollo de software trabajamos constantemente con texto: nombres de usuarios, mensajes, datos importados, logs, comunicación entre servicios… y detrás de todo ese texto existe un concepto fundamental que a menudo pasa desapercibido: el character set o conjunto de caracteres. Si los character codes representan “cómo se codifica un

Ver Blog »

Character Code

En el desarrollo de software hay conceptos que parecen simples hasta que un día causan un bug extraño y, de repente, se convierten en una fuente de frustración y aprendizaje. Uno de esos conceptos es el character code, la forma en que las computadoras representan los símbolos que vemos en

Ver Blog »

CHAOS METHOD

Dentro del ecosistema del desarrollo de software existen metodologías para todos los gustos. Algunas son rígidas y estructuradas; otras, tan flexibles que parecen filosofías de vida. Y luego existe algo que no está en los manuales, no aparece en certificaciones y, sin embargo, es sorprendentemente común en equipos de todas

Ver Blog »

Visita a 42 Madrid

MSMK participa en un taller de Inteligencia Artificial en 42 Madrid     Madrid, [18/11/2025] Los alumnos de MSMK University College, participaron en un taller intensivo de Inteligencia Artificial aplicada al desarrollo web en 42 Madrid, uno de los campus tecnológicos más innovadores de Europa. La actividad tuvo como objetivo que

Ver Blog »
Query Language

Query Language

Definición de Lenguaje de Consulta en IA El lenguaje de consulta en inteligencia artificial es una herramienta formal utilizada para interactuar con bases de datos, sistemas de conocimiento o modelos inteligentes mediante preguntas estructuradas. Su objetivo principal es recuperar, filtrar o inferir información relevante de forma eficiente, especialmente cuando los

Ver Blog »
Quantum Computing

Quantum Computing

¿Qué es la Computación Cuántica? La computación cuántica es un nuevo paradigma de procesamiento de información basado en las leyes de la mecánica cuántica. A diferencia de la computación clásica, que utiliza bits que solo pueden estar en 0 o 1, la computación cuántica emplea qubits, los cuales pueden estar

Ver Blog »

Déjanos tus datos, nosotros te llamamos

Leave us your details and we will send you the program link.

Déjanos tus datos y 
te enviaremos el link del white paper

Déjanos tus datos y 
te enviaremos el link de la revista

Déjanos tus datos y 
te enviaremos el link del programa